وَحَدَّثَنِى أَبُو الطَّاهِرِ حَدَّثَنَا ابْنُ وَهْبٍ ح وَحَدَّثَنَا حَرْمَلَةُ بْنُ يَحْيَى التُّجِيبِىُّ أَخْبَرَنَا ابْنُ وَهْبٍ أَخْبَرَنِى يُونُسُ عَنِ ابْنِ شِهَابٍ عَنِ ابْنِ الْمُسَيَّبِ وَأَبِى سَلَمَةَ بْنِ عَبْدِ الرَّحْمَنِ أَنَّ أَبَا هُرَيْرَةَ قَالَ اقْتَتَلَتِ امْرَأَتَانِ مِنْ هُذَيْلٍ فَرَمَتْ إِحْدَاهُمَا الأُخْرَى بِحَجَرٍ فَقَتَلَتْهَا وَمَا فِى بَطْنِهَا فَاخْتَصَمُوا إِلَى رَسُولِ اللَّهِ -صلى الله عليه وسلم- فَقَضَى رَسُولُ اللَّهِ -صلى الله عليه وسلم- أَنَّ دِيَةَ جَنِينِهَا غُرَّةٌ عَبْدٌ أَوْ وَلِيدَةٌ وَقَضَى بِدِيَةِ الْمَرْأَةِ عَلَى عَاقِلَتِهَا وَوَرَّثَهَا وَلَدَهَا وَمَنْ مَعَهُمْ فَقَالَ حَمَلُ بْنُ النَّابِغَةِ الْهُذَلِىُّ يَا رَسُولَ اللَّهِ كَيْفَ أَغْرَمُ مَنْ لاَ شَرِبَ وَلاَ أَكَلَ وَلاَ نَطَقَ وَلاَ اسْتَهَلَّ فَمِثْلُ ذَلِكَ يُطَلُّ. فَقَالَ رَسُولُ اللَّهِ -صلى الله عليه وسلم- « إِنَّمَا هَذَا مِنْ إِخْوَانِ الْكُهَّانِ ». مِنْ أَجْلِ سَجْعِهِ الَّذِى سَجَعَ.
Abu Hurairah said: "Two women from Hudhail fought and one of them threw a rock at the other and killed her and the child in her womb. They referred the matter to the Messenger of Allah (s.a.w), and the Messenger of Allah (s.a.w) ruled that the Diyah for her fetus was a slave, male or female, and he ruled that the Diyah for the woman be paid by her (the killer's) 'A.qilah, and that her children and those who were with her would inherit her estate. Hamal bin An-Nabighah Al-Hudhali said: 'O Messenger of Allah, how can a penalty be paid for one who did not drink or eat, or speak or make any sound (he said so rhyming the words in a poetic way)? Such a one should be overlooked.' The Messenger of Allah (s.a.w) said: 'This man is one of the brothers of the soothsayers,' because of the rhymed speech with which he spoke."
